Question rear defroster

Hi, i noticed that the rear defroster does not work in the middle area of the back window. any ideas what this issue is caused by? maybe a fuse issue? thanks in advance.

hey guys, yeah i read that from a few other places but i'm not exactly on how it works. something about applying masking tape that it comes with and putting conductive paint over the affected strips. can anyone that's ever tried it tell me if it's several lines do you paints each entire strip? seeing as how the kit comes with a very tiny bottle...

You paint over the broken part of the strip...on every broken part. If there are multiple spots, then yes, you have to paint every one.
